The Current State of Online Gambling in Virginia

Virginia has taken a progressive approach to gambling expansion, but traditional online gambling Virginia options remain limited compared to states like New Jersey or Pennsylvania. Here’s what’s currently legal:

✅ Sports Betting – Fully legal since 2021 (FanDuel, DraftKings, BetMGM, etc.)
✅ Horse Racing Betting – Permitted through licensed platforms
✅ Daily Fantasy Sports (DFS) – Legal and regulated
✅ Sweepstakes & Social Casinos – Allowed (e.g., Chumba Casino, LuckyLand Slots)
❌ Traditional Online Casinos – Not yet legalized (but offshore sites operate in a gray area)

For now, Virginians looking for real money online casino Virginia action must rely on offshore gambling sites or sweepstakes models.

Taxes on Online Gambling Winnings in Virginia

Yes, the IRS requires reporting online gambling Virginia winnings:

  • Slot Jackpots (Report if over $1,200)

  • Table Game Wins (Report if over $600)

  • Sports Betting (All net winnings taxable)

Virginia doesn’t impose a state gambling tax, but federal taxes apply.
